## Formula sandbox tuning

User-supplied formulas in Gridmoor execute inside a restricted interpreter with hard ceilings on time, memory, and call depth. Reviewers should confirm any change to these ceilings is justified in the PR description, since raising them widens the abuse surface. Defaults were chosen from production traces. The current limits are as follows.

limits module of tafog-fawip:
WEIGHTS = {
    "julix": 57,
    "lamys": 992,
    "kasvan": 209,
    "quenok": 750,
    "alddor": 259,
    "oliath": 1009,
    "wenix": 815,
}

Subject: PedalShift 2.4 released

Plugin authors: PedalShift 2.4 is now live on the release channel. The rebalancing scheduler hooks have changed signatures; van-capacity callbacks now receive dock cluster IDs instead of station names. Update your manifests before the 2.3 sunset next month. Full changelog is on the wiki. The build token for this release follows below.

pipeline stamp: htk9_b3279b371

Quarterly Planning Note — Sorrelmark Insurance Desk

Sales leads: the group liability policy with Quenby Mutual renews next quarter. Premiums are expected to rise given last year's Ashfold warehouse claim. Please hold all client commitments involving extended coverage until terms are confirmed. Negotiation strategy and related commercial intentions are detailed in the confidential note that follows.

management briefing: The renewal with Quenathox Group closes at $10 million a year, 20 percent below the last contract. Project Ulawyn slips by two quarters because of the supplier delay.